This course includes terminology and technique in elementary ballet including alignment, barre, center work, basic enchainements, and room and body directions, with emphasis on developing the physical and expressive potential of the human body. The class will enable students to understand and synthesize` the kinesiological and anatomical, historical and theoretical and aesthetic of dance. General Education Performing Art. May be repeated for credit.
